This painting features a sketch of an angel playing a flute, with large wings spread out to the sides. The angel is dressed in a flowing robe and has short hair. The sketch is drawn in black ink on a light brown background. The angel's facial expression is calm and serene, with a slight smile on its face. The flute is held up to the angel's lips, and its wings are spread out in a gentle, curved motion. The overall effect of the sketch is one of peacefulness and tranquility. Jan Alojzy Matejko (Polish pronunciation: ; also known as Jan Mateyko; 24 June 1838 – 1 November 1893) was a Polish painter, a leading 19th-century exponent of history painting, known for depicting nodal events from Polish history.
